Itinerary Notes & Tips

Gwalior to Chittorgarh

  • 3:50pm to 5:00am – Ride train from Gwalior to Chittorgarh via Train#19665 (Kurj Udz Exp)
    • AC3 B2 coach class – R835
  • 5:00am – Arrival at Chittorgarh Railway Station
  • Leave luggage at cloakroom – R15

Chittorgarh Fort

  • Ride autorickshaw from the railway station to Chittorgarh Fort – R10
    • Drop off at the first gate
  • Walk uphill to the seventh gate
  • Hillside Waterfall
  • Pay Chittorgarh Fort admission fee – R10 (local)
  • Chittorgarh Fort Walking Tour
    • Victory Tower
    • Rana Kumbha’s Palace
    • Padmini’s Palace (Queen’s Palace)
    • Meera Temple
    • Kalika Mata Temple
    • Fateh Prakash Palace
    • Jain Temples
    • Gaumukh Reservoir

Chittorgarh to Udaipur

  • Ride autorickshaw from the seventh gate to the first gate – R10
  • Ride autorickshaw from the first gate to bus stand – R10
  • Ride autorickshaw from bus stand to railway station – R10
  • 7:00pm – Arrival at Chittorgarh Railway Station
  • 7:25pm to 9:30pm – Ride train from Chittorgarh to Udaipur via Train#12992
    • Sleeper class – R75
